引言
随着互联网技术的发展,网页设计已经从简单的信息展示转变为充满互动性和视觉冲击力的体验。jQuery作为一款流行的JavaScript库,极大地简化了网页开发的复杂度。而jQuery插件则让开发者能够轻松实现各种酷炫的网页效果。本文将深入探讨jQuery插件的使用技巧,帮助开发者掌握必备的技能。
一、jQuery插件概述
1.1 什么是jQuery插件?
jQuery插件是扩展jQuery功能的代码库,它允许开发者在不修改jQuery核心代码的情况下,增加新的功能。这些插件可以是简单的功能,如日期选择器、表单验证等,也可以是复杂的动画、图表等。
1.2 jQuery插件的优点
- 提高开发效率:插件提供了现成的功能,减少了从头开始编写代码的时间。
- 增强用户体验:插件可以实现丰富的交互效果,提升网页的视觉效果和用户体验。
- 易于维护:插件通常由社区维护,更新及时,易于修复和升级。
二、jQuery插件的使用方法
2.1 引入jQuery库
在使用jQuery插件之前,首先需要确保已经在网页中引入了jQuery库。可以通过CDN或者本地文件的方式引入。
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
2.2 引入插件
接下来,需要将插件文件引入到HTML中。同样可以通过CDN或者本地文件的方式引入。
<script src="path/to/plugin.js"></script>
2.3 使用插件
在HTML元素上添加特定的类名或ID,并在jQuery代码中调用插件的方法。
$(document).ready(function(){
$("#element").pluginName();
});
三、常见jQuery插件介绍
3.1 Bootstrap插件
Bootstrap是一个流行的前端框架,它提供了丰富的jQuery插件。例如,模态框(Modal)、轮播图(Carousel)等。
3.2 jQuery UI插件
jQuery UI是一个基于jQuery的UI工具包,它包含了丰富的交互组件和效果。例如,日期选择器(Datepicker)、拖放(Draggable)等。
3.3 Animate.css插件
Animate.css是一个纯CSS3动画库,它可以通过jQuery插件的方式使用。例如,淡入淡出(Fade In/Out)、缩放(Scale)等。
四、jQuery插件的注意事项
4.1 选择合适的插件
在选择jQuery插件时,应考虑以下因素:
- 功能:插件是否提供了所需的功能。
- 兼容性:插件是否与使用的浏览器兼容。
- 性能:插件是否会对网页性能产生负面影响。
- 社区支持:插件是否有活跃的社区支持。
4.2 避免过度依赖插件
虽然jQuery插件可以简化开发,但过度依赖插件可能会导致以下问题:
- 代码臃肿:引入过多的插件会导致代码量增加,难以维护。
- 性能下降:过多的插件和复杂的交互效果会降低网页性能。
五、总结
jQuery插件为开发者提供了丰富的工具,可以帮助实现各种酷炫的网页效果。通过本文的介绍,相信读者已经对jQuery插件有了更深入的了解。在今后的开发过程中,选择合适的插件,掌握使用技巧,将有助于提升网页质量和用户体验。
